I did laugh when they got into the gunfight at the sub. If I were Jack, the first thing I would have said to Flocke would be "Go get 'em." I mean, they have an invulnerable monster that can take out groups of people with no effort. In fact, he did it IN THIS EPISODE. But they still had to shoot it out with a bunch of people to take the sub, simply so Kate could get shot. Here's a tip, writers...don't give one of your characters super powers and then forget they have them.

#1 Ben was at the temple and Roger had just shot Sayid when the Incident occurred. It is very unlikely they managed to escape before the bomb went off.
#2 Roger didn't indicate that they were lucky to get off the island. He said, "Imagine how different our lives would have been if we'd stayed." Sounds more like regret. And definitely doesn't sound like the island was destroyed shortly after they left.
